High Speed Font
About the High Speed Font
Make a bold statement with High Speed Font, a powerful and memorable font. High Speed is a bold and italic display font. It is inspired by extreme sports and it will look great in posters, games, book covers and anything that requires a cool look!
High Speed’s aggressive italic lends itself perfectly to headlines, posters, and branding for products related to action sports, gaming, or high-performance technology. It’s less suitable for body text or UI elements due to its bold weight and italic style, which can hinder readability in extended passages.
Consider pairing High Speed with a clean sans-serif like Open Sans for body copy or a geometric sans-serif like Futura for a more modern, balanced feel. For a slightly softer contrast, a neutral serif like Garamond can add sophistication while still maintaining the font’s energetic personality.
The font projects a rebellious, high-energy personality ideal for brands seeking to convey speed, excitement, and a sense of adventure. Avoid using it for projects requiring elegance or subtlety; its strength lies in its dynamism and bold visual impact.
